Entry-Level Data Analyst Salary in Santa Clara, CA: $72,982 (2026)
Quick Answer:New data analysts entering the Santa Clara, CA job market in 2026 can expect a starting salary around $72,982 (BLS 10th-percentile benchmark for SOC 15-2051, projected from 2025 OEWS data). Stripping out Santa Clara's local price level (BEA RPP 113.1 — 13% above national), a first-year paycheck buys what $64,529 would in average-cost America. Starting Your data analysis Career in Santa Clara
Employers that frequently hire new grad data analysts in Santa Clara include major FAANG companies, which typically recruit through structured programs tailored for Master's and PhD graduates, often offering substantial equity packages and bonuses. Specialized companies such as AI labs and quantitative trading firms look for candidates with advanced degrees, while consulting firms prefer individuals with a blend of quantitative skills and business acumen. The right credentials can significantly boost starting pay, especially for those holding a Master's or PhD in fields like computer science or statistics, along with skills in Python and machine learning frameworks. New analysts should focus on building a strong portfolio and potentially engaging in Kaggle competitions to enhance their job prospects. In the first few years, salary increments are realistic but modest compared to the more significant compensation packages found in senior roles, which may exceed $300,000. Understanding these dynamics can help recent graduates navigate their early careers effectively and set realistic salary expectations as they progress.
